What is Franks Restaurant?
Franks Restaurant is a multi-generational hospitality enterprise that has evolved from a modest local eatery into a significant regional dining destination. Founded in 1970, the company has demonstrated remarkable resilience, overcoming historical challenges such as facility destruction to expand into a comprehensive dining and sports bar complex. Beyond its commercial operations, the firm is recognized for its deep integration into the local social fabric, maintaining long-standing partnerships with educational institutions and emergency services. The business model is anchored in a diverse menu and a commitment to community-centric service, which has allowed it to maintain a competitive advantage in the Georgia market for over four decades.
How much funding has Franks Restaurant raised?
Franks Restaurant has raised a total of $326K across 2 funding rounds:
Debt
$150K
Debt
$176K
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P
Debt (2021): $176K led by PPP
